Output 3352505eca056a9bf77fa39873d1bc05bdc3e9f2904d2718af8e23df789d0aa4:0

value
2571487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b386d973a651dd93548e9d24311c1ab4c8f08dd OP_EQUAL
address
34AwmR44Ztc1rJ6SRXYiVFJCMeiBacSRBZ
transaction
3352505eca056a9bf77fa39873d1bc05bdc3e9f2904d2718af8e23df789d0aa4
spent
true